How to Custom Cut Foam for Gun Cases

Custom cutting foam for a Pelican gun case is a process that ensures your firearms are snugly nestled and protected during transport or storage. Whether you are a hobbyist, hunter, or professional, properly fitted foam not only secures your firearms but also prevents damage caused by movement and impact. Follow these steps to tailor foam inserts for your Pelican gun case:

Assess Your Needs

Begin by evaluating the layout of your firearms and accessories. Determine the dimensions of your Pelican gun case and the items you intend to store inside. Understanding the arrangement will guide you in planning the foam cutouts.

Select the Right Foam

Opt for foam inserts specifically designed for customizing Pelican gun cases. These Pelican gun case foams are often available in different thicknesses and densities. Choose a foam density that provides adequate cushioning without being too soft or too firm.

Gather Tools

You will need precise tools for cutting foam. A sharp utility knife or an electric carving knife works well for this task. Additionally, consider using a marker for outlining and measuring tools for accuracy.

Create a Template

Before cutting the foam, it is advisable to create a template of your items on a piece of cardboard or paper. This allows you to plan the layout and ensures that your cutouts are accurately positioned.

Mark the Foam

Place the foam sheet inside your Pelican gun case. Using your template as a guide, mark the outline of your firearms and accessories onto the foam with a marker. Take your time with this step to ensure precision.

Cut the Foam

With the outlines marked, carefully cut out the shapes using your utility knife or electric carving knife. Start by making shallow cuts and gradually deepen them until you reach the desired depth. Take caution not to cut too deep, as this can compromise the structural integrity of the foam.

Test Fit

After cutting out the shapes, test the fit of your firearms and accessories in the foam inserts. They should fit snugly without being too tight. Make any necessary adjustments by trimming or reshaping the foam as needed.

Fine-Tune

Pay attention to details such as trigger guards, scopes, and other protruding parts. Use a finer cutting tool or sandpaper to refine the edges and ensure a precise fit. The goal is to create a seamless custom foam insert that securely holds your items in place.

Finalize

Once you are satisfied with the fit, clean any debris or excess foam from the inserts. Ensure that all cutouts are smooth and free of rough edges. Your custom foam inserts are now ready to protect your firearms in your Pelican gun case.

Remember, patience and precision are key when custom cutting foam for your Pelican gun case. Take your time during each step of the process to ensure a professional-looking result.
